AI Summary
This bill prohibits consumer reporting agencies and lenders from using an individual's late payment of cashless tolls to determine their creditworthiness. It amends the General Business Law and the Banking Law to prevent the use of late cashless toll payments as a factor in assessing a consumer's credit standing or capacity. The bill also requires the Superintendent of Financial Services to ensure that credit scoring formulas do not include variables related to late cashless toll payments.
